Volunteers save displaced people from the cold: a great initiative of the BF "Noble Cause"

In October, the team of the Charitable Foundation "Noble Cause" and its head Serhiy Shutov launched a new initiative, which is very relevant for thousands of families in the southern regions of our country.

In view of the fact that the winter cold will soon come, the volunteers decided to provide firewood to the residents of several OTS of Odesa. Recently, thousands of displaced persons from the south of Ukraine have arrived here, in the Odesa region, fleeing the war. That is why the local authorities of some OTG turned to the Fund with a request for help - people are in dire need of firewood or stoves.

In order to help our citizens who were in trouble get through the winter more easily, it was necessary to act as soon as possible, the Charitable Fund Team accepted the challenge - negotiations with partners and friends began, the search for opportunities...

As a result, in the shortest possible time, the first batches of firewood (which are two full trucks of 40 cubic meters of wood) went to the village of Kulivcha in the Sarat district. As Serhiy Shutov admits, the reaction of the people was a real shock for him – many of them cried while receiving firewood.

"Each family that needed it received one and a half cubic meters of hard wood - this is oak, alder, ash, which means that heat in people's houses will be provided for the next one and a half to two months. We will not stop there, we plan to continue and further increase our humanitarian aid: especially since we are constantly receiving new requests," said Serhii Shutov.

By the way, partners from the humanitarian organization Nova Ukraine and Protestant churches, which have long provided assistance not only to their parishioners, but also to all those who need it, helped the volunteers in the purchase and delivery of firewood.

The Charitable Fund's immediate plans include assistance to the recently liberated districts of the Mykolaiv region. The situation there is even more deplorable, as many houses have been destroyed by the occupiers: people need both firewood and small stoves. The first batch of "bourgeois" will arrive at the fund already this week and will be distributed to people immediately.

Well, as always, the priority of the Fund is to help the defenders of our country. Several times a month, volunteers go to the front line, to the servicemen of the 28th brigade, who have been helping them for the ninth month.

Benefactors take the boys to the front as food, medicine, sets of tactical uniforms and shoes, as well as what our heroes have asked for more than once - much-needed sleeping bags.
